
Oklahoma City residents can expect a sunny start to the week with temperatures climbing to a comfortable high near 73 degrees, according to the National Weather Service. The clear skies come with a brisk south-southwest wind blowing at 13 to 16 mph, and gusts that may reach upwards of 26 mph. The evening will stay mostly clear with a low around 46 degrees as winds shift to the west-northwest post-midnight. For more details, visit National Weather Service Oklahoma City.
The forecast for Tuesday remains sunny with a high near 69 degrees, and slightly calmer north winds blowing at a gentle 3 to 8 mph. Transitioning into Tuesday night, Oklahoma City will see partly cloudy skies with a low hovering around 45 degrees. Come Wednesday, Oklahomans can expect partly sunny weather with temperatures reaching near 70 degrees and south winds picking back up to 6 to 11 mph, including possible gusts as high as 21 mph, as reported by the National Weather Service.
Wednesday night will be mostly cloudy with a small chance of showers after midnight. Lows will be around 55°. Thursday brings a higher chance of showers with some sun, and highs near 68°. Rain chances drop Thursday night as temperatures fall to about 42°. By Friday, it will be mostly sunny and cooler, with a high near 54°, as per the National Weather Service.
Saturday will be sunny with a high around 56°, and a clear, colder night with lows near 30°. Sunday will also be sunny with a high close to 54°.
